Mildred J. James was a teacher
Mildred J. James, 86, passed away on April 12, 2023, at her home.
Mildred was born December 17, 1936 in Bluffton, to Waldo and Glenna (Stewart) Hanna who preceded her in death. On December 22, 1956 she married E. Elwood James who preceded her in death on July 23, 2019.
She was a graduate of Cory-Rawson High School and later obtained a bachelor’s degree in teaching from Ohio Northern University. She was a life-long member of Pleasant View United Methodist Church. She was also an active member of Findlay Glass Club, Melody Circle, the Gathering Basket, and the Retired Teachers Association. She enjoyed gardening, collecting teddy bears, traveling with her sister Carolyn, cross-stitch, knitting, reading, and Findlay Glass. She also hosted several exchange students; Estella, Martha and Joe. She enjoyed being with her family, especially her grandchildren.
She is survived by her three children, Carol Steegman of Arlington, Kurtis (Mary) James of Jenera, and Matthew James of Findlay; five grandchildren, Jamie Steegman, Mackenzie (Tyler Snyder) James, Loryn Morton, Abbigail (Brandon) Falk, and Morgan (Dakota) Lenhart; eight great grandchildren and one on the way; a sister, Carolyn May of Elyria, OH; a nephew, Karl (Ann) Moyer of Anderson, IN; two sisters-in-law, Joanne Hawk of Findlay and Dorothy James of Dunkirk; numerous nieces and nephews; and family friend, Stephanie James.
In addition to her parents and her husband, Mildred was preceded in death by a sister, Delores Moyer.
